#7d467e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7d467e is composed of 49% red, 27.5%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.8% cyan, 44.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 298.9 degrees, a saturation of 28.6% and a lightness of 38.4%. #7d467e color hex could be obtained by blending #fa8cfc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

Shades and Tints of #7d467e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c070d is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#7d467e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#675d67 is the less saturated color, while #be02c2 is the most saturated one.
